Press Release – Lime Launches Lime Hero Partnership to Raise Money for YWCA in Spokane

Spokane, WA (April 10, 2025) – Lime e-scooter and e-bike riders in Spokane can now help support survivors of domestic violence while addressing systemic inequalities for women and girls. Lime’s new Lime Hero partnership with YWCA Spokane will allow riders to opt-in to round up the cost of their rides to make donations to YWCA.

Media Alert – YWCA Spokane’s Women of Achievement Luncheon Results

Spokane, WA – YWCA Spokane proudly announces the success of its 43rd annual Women of Achievement Awards Luncheon, a powerful celebration of leadership, resilience, and community support. This year’s event honored 9 outstanding women for their extraordinary contributions and raised a net total of over $260,000 in support of YWCA Spokane’s vital services for women, children, and survivors of domestic violence.

Housing Walk-In Clinic

Every Monday and Wednesday, YWCA Spokane provides a walk-in housing clinic for survivors impacted by intimate partner domestic violence.
